Involuntary Bankruptcy. If (a) a petition is filed against Grantor seeking to rearrange, reorganize or extinguish its debts under the provisions of any bankruptcy or other debtor relief law of the United States or any state or other competent jurisdiction, and such petition is not dismissed or withdrawn within sixty (60) days after its filing, or (b) a court of competent jurisdiction enters an order, judgment or decree appointing, without the consent of Grantor a receiver or trustee for it, or for all or any part of its property, and such order, judgment, or decree is not dismissed, withdrawn or reversed within sixty (60) days after the date of entry of such order, judgment or decree.
